Christer Strömholm
(Sweden, 1918-2002)

"Clips, Santa Monica, 1963"

Signed CHR Strömholm and with fingerprint on the mount. Gelatin silver print mounted on cardboard, sheet 29.5 x 22.5 cm.

Provenance

Bukowski Auktioner, Höstens Contemporary 588, 2015, lot 206.

Exhibitions

Liljevalchs Konsthall, Stockholm, "396 Fotografiska förälskelser", 2001, another example exhibited.
Moderna Museet, Stockholm, "Arbus, Model, Strömholm", 1 October 2005 - 15 January 2006, another example exhibited.
Moderna Museet, Stockholm, "Ett sätt att leva. Svensk fotografi från Christer Strömholm till idag", 1 February - 18 May 2014, another example exhibited.

Literature

Anders Jonason and Christer Strömholm, "Konsten att vara där", 1991, illustrated full-page p. 93.
Joakim & Jakob Strömholm, "Christer Strömholm 1918-2002, On verra bien", 2002, illustrated full-page p. 133.
Joakim Strömholm och Patric Leo (ed.), "Post Scriptum Christer Strömholm", 2012, illustrated full-page p. 243.

More information

This motif is included in the collections at the Moderna Museet in Stockholm.
